Key Buying Factors for Car Refrigerators for Trucks
Capacity and Footprint
Think about both total quart size and where the fridge will sit. A compact model may be ideal in a tight cab, while a larger unit is better for truck beds, trailers, or camping setups.
Power and Efficiency
Most Car Refrigerators for Trucks run on 12V DC, and many also support 24V or AC use. If you plan to power the unit while parked, check energy use, battery protection settings, and whether the compressor is designed for steady overnight operation.
Temperature Range
Not every driver needs deep freezing. If you mainly want cold drinks and lunch storage, a moderate range is enough. If you carry meat, frozen meals, or need longer food preservation, choose a unit with stronger cooling and freezing capability.
Controls and Convenience
Digital displays, app control, interior baskets, drain plugs, and dual-zone layouts can make day-to-day use easier. For frequent travelers, simple controls and clear temperature readouts are especially valuable.
Durability and Truck Use
Look for a sturdy build, secure lid closure, and a design that can handle vibration and movement. If the fridge will live in a work truck, durability should matter as much as cooling performance.
